According to the National Associations of Realtors, about 38% of real estate agents are currently using videos in their marketing activities, while 30% percent reported that they didn’t use video marketing. The other 32% of realtors informed the association that they don’t currently use video marketing, but plans to do it in the near future.

oes video help sell real estate?

The quick answer is yes. Using a video works not only on the buyer side, but also on the seller side.

85% of buyers and sellers want to work with a broker who uses a video. This means that using a video to sell a property is already halfway to a successful deal.

Properties offered with a video receive four times more inquiries than properties offered without a video

Using video in emails doubles click-through rates and reduces unsubscribes by 75 percent

What are the four reasons to use video?

There are four important reasons to use video in your real estate marketing

  • First, it is critical for most businesses – and especially for professional service providers such as lawyers, dentists or real estate agents – that the client or potential client feels comfortable with and trusts the person with whom they are doing business. Video marketing puts a face and personality to a company’s name and helps build that all-important trust and rapport. People like to do business with people. A video is the closest thing to a face-to-face conversation.
  • Another reason is that videos give viewers more information faster than reading a property description or scrolling through a photo slideshow. Buyers can access all this information with a press of the play button. Viewers can get an idea of the rooms and layout of the property, and get a sense of the neighborhood.
  • Because videos save you time and money. In a 3-minute video, you can give viewers your business or service background, introduce your products, showcase your team, or answer questions, just to name a few possibilities. And that one video – or better yet, a series of videos – can be watched and shared repeatedly 24 hours a day, seven days a week, on almost any platform or marketing channel. And with videos, you can add a Call To Action (CTA) asking the viewer to take a desired action. This could be downloading a piece of content (in exchange for their contact info), signing up for a 101 home buyer’s class, or to schedule a meeting. These CTAs allow current and future clients to connect with your business and move further down the sales funnel.
  • And finally, real estate agents should use video because they will help your website’s rankings on Google and other search engines. This is done in a number of ways including optimizing how the videos are uploaded to YouTube or embedded on your website. It also includes how the videos are constructed from script and storyboard to editing and rendering. With time, you will increase your page ranking in particular searches and you will see more traffic coming to your website.
